mysql备份和还原数据库
生活随笔
收集整理的這篇文章主要介紹了
mysql备份和还原数据库
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
備份數據庫:
/usr/local/kkmail/service/mysql/bin/mysqldump -u kkmail -p --databases kkmail |gzip>20180309.sql.gz
還原數據庫:
停止和數據庫相關的服務、解壓備份的sql數據庫文件、還原數據庫、最后開啟這些服務:
for i in kkmail_app kkmail_nginx kkmail_apache kkmail_dovecot kkmail_redis kkmail_postfix;do /etc/init.d/$i stop;done
gunzip 20180309.sql.gz
/usr/local/kkmail/service/mysql/bin/mysql -ukkmail -p kkmail <20180309.sql
for i in kkmail_app kkmail_nginx kkmail_apache kkmail_dovecot kkmail_redis kkmail_postfix;do /etc/init.d/$i start;done
思考:備份的時候是否要鎖表。
轉載于:https://blog.51cto.com/net881004/2084578
《新程序員》:云原生和全面數字化實踐50位技術專家共同創作,文字、視頻、音頻交互閱讀總結
以上是生活随笔為你收集整理的mysql备份和还原数据库的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: React入门---react脚手架
- 下一篇: Java 8 Date-Time API